So, let's go directly to the exchange of money. Like any product, money exchange transactions have a price. This means that the money of different countries in relation to each other is also a commodity. It follows that a certain amount of banknotes of one country costs a certain amount of banknotes of another country. Value data - exchange rates - are calculated based on many macroeconomic indicators. As a result, the final exchange rate is determined for the final consumer who wants to conduct a currency exchange transaction. Also, this operation will require compliance with certain rules.

In order to convert 1000 hryvnias to rubles, we arm ourselves with a passport and go to the bank. But before that, you should definitely clarify the exchange rate.

The ratio of different currencies is constantly changing. These courses are updated once a day. They are presented, as a rule, in the form of tables. So, as of May 26, 2014, in banks, the ruble exchange rate against the hryvnia was 0.310 for sale and 0.352 for purchase.
